with Ada.Strings.Unbounded;
with Ada.Text_IO;
with Ada.Text_IO.Unbounded_IO;
with Ada.Command_Line;
with GNAT.Command_Line;
with GNAT.Strings;
with Hypervisor_Check; use Hypervisor_Check;
with HVInfo_Util; use HVInfo_Util;
procedure HVInfo is
package US renames Ada.Strings.Unbounded;
package CL renames Ada.Command_Line;
package IO renames Ada.Text_IO;
package GCL renames GNAT.Command_Line;
CPUID_HV_Name, SMBIOS_HV_Name, Hypervisor_Name : US.Unbounded_String;
begin
-- Handle command line options
declare
-- No declarations
begin
loop
case GCL.Getopt ("-help -version") is
when '-' =>
if GCL.Full_Switch = "-version" then
Print_Version;
return;
elsif GCL.Full_Switch = "-help" then
Print_Help;
return;
end if;
when others =>
exit;
end case;
end loop;
exception
when GCL.Invalid_Switch =>
IO.Put_Line ("Invalid option");
Print_Help;
return;
end;
CPUID_HV_Name := US.To_Unbounded_String ("");
SMBIOS_HV_Name := US.To_Unbounded_String ("");
if Hypervisor_Present then
CPUID_HV_Name := Get_Vendor_Name;
end if;
SMBIOS_HV_Name := Get_DMI_Vendor_Name;
declare
use US;
begin
if (CPUID_HV_Name = "") and (SMBIOS_HV_Name = "") then
CL.Set_Exit_Status (1);
elsif (CPUID_HV_Name /= "") then
CL.Set_Exit_Status (0);
UIO.Put_Line (CPUID_HV_Name);
else
CL.Set_Exit_Status (0);
UIO.Put_Line (SMBIOS_HV_Name);
end if;
end;
end HVInfo;
